Output 94911276846cfabac9585b23df62756677a46ec186f2ee58fea281c33ee3fa93:1

value
2051396
script pubkey
OP_0 OP_PUSHBYTES_20 c1b2c26a3f91a6e023bae10f2764b590ae27a87a
address
ltc1qcxevy63ljxnwqga6uy8jwe94jzhz02r66z7fwy
transaction
94911276846cfabac9585b23df62756677a46ec186f2ee58fea281c33ee3fa93
spent
true